Other Alice Cooper Stage Props We Want To Buy
The original guillotine used on Alice Cooper’s 1973 Billion Dollar Babies Tour will be hitting the auction block soon, and it got us thinking of other awesome props from the Godfather of Shock Rock that we’d like to own. In honor of Alice’s birthday today (February 4th), here’s just a selection we’d like to add to our own memorabilia collections.
Severed Head
If you have the guillotine, you have to have one of Alice’s severed heads. They should really be a package deal when you think about it.
